As part of the London Road project team the artist, Chris Tipping created a concept for a simple, elegant and uncluttered public realm which uses quality materials and paving patterns to emphasise existing focal points, meeting places, thresholds, makers and gateways.A key feature is a series of striking black terrazzo seats, which include two, 3m diameter seats in the form of the rose or sexfoil window of the former St. Paul's Church. Destroyed during the bombing of November 1940, the church stood at the heart of London Road, opposite Vernon Walk and was the focus of religious and social life. Each seat is inlaid with extracts from the historical records of many of the varied clubs and societies that would regularly meet in the church hall. Bespoke terrazzo benches by Pallam Precast Ltd.
